Morning: Depart Delhi early and enjoy the open highway as you head towards the Pink City. Stop at the historic Neemrana Fort for a quick coffee and panoramic views.
Afternoon: Arrive in Jaipur and explore the magnificent City Palace, followed by a stroll through the vibrant Jantar Mantar observatory.
Evening: Dine at a rooftop restaurant overlooking the illuminated Hawa Mahal and relax at your boutique hotel.

Afternoon: Continue to Udaipur, checking into a lakeside resort before exploring the majestic City Palace and its museum.
Evening: Enjoy a romantic boat ride on Pichola Lake, watching the sunset behind the City Palace.

Afternoon: Visit the tranquil Dudh Talai viewpoint and the historic Dilwara Temples, renowned for their marble carvings.
Evening: Relax in the cool mountain air at a cozy cottage, savoring a candlelit dinner.

Afternoon: Arrive and explore the grand Sabarmati Ashram, followed by a visit to the intricate Adalaj Stepwell.
Evening: Stroll along the bustling Manek Chowk market, sampling local street food before checking into a heritage hotel.

Afternoon: Arrive at the Great Rann of Kutch and experience the surreal salt flats, optionally taking a camel ride.
Evening: Witness a magical sunset over the white expanse, followed by a traditional Rajasthani‑Gujarati dinner under the stars.

If you need to shorten the trip, skip Mount Abu and head straight from Udaipur to Ahmedabad, reducing travel time while still experiencing the highlights of Gujarat.
